Radio Over Moscow is an independent ‘band’ based in Auckland, New Zealand. I say ‘band’ as at this stage, it’s just me, but hey.

The debut album ‘Battletech’ was released on July 18, 2009, and the follow up, ‘Hide The Decline’, on April 23, 2010.

If nothing else, ROM sounds like a low-budget mix of Depeche Mode, Nirvana, New Order, Killers, Smashing Pumpkins, Beatles, Weezer, Human League, Manic Street Preachers, Primal Scream and Blur.

ROM is completely independent - if you pay for a track, the only people getting any money are myself and whichever service you buy the music through. The albums can be downloaded for free, or $NZ5 (minimum) in expanded, ‘deluxe’ formats.
